The snapshot
- •Closings tracked, last 12 months: 211
- •Median sold price, last 12 months: $490,000
- •Median sold $/sqft, last 12 months: $282
- •Middle half of sales closed between: $425,000 and $599,900
What the numbers say
Resideline tracked 211 closed sales in Edgewater over the last 12 months, with a median closing price of $490,000. That median is the midpoint of what buyers actually paid, not what sellers hoped to get, which is why it moves differently from the asking prices you see on listing sites. The middle half of those sales closed between $425,000 and $599,900. That spread matters more than the headline median: where a specific property sits inside it decides whether the citywide number helps you or misleads you. These are the closings Resideline tracks and may differ from complete county or municipal records. Across the 210 closings with usable living area, the middle half sold between $223 and $350 per square foot.

Where Edgewater sale prices land
Medians hide the shape of a market. The distribution above covers the closed sales Resideline tracked in Edgewater over the last 12 months that carry a usable sale date, trimmed to the 5th through 95th percentile, with the middle half of sales closing between $425,000 and $599,900. Among the 40 Maryland markets with a published band, Edgewater's middle-half spread ($425,000 to $599,900) ranks 4th from the narrowest. Where your target property sits inside that spread matters more than the citywide median. Measured as the ratio of the upper to the lower quartile, its middle-half spread ranks in the 13th percentile of the 2,187 US markets in Resideline's national Market Watch set, on data as of September 4, 2026.
How long a sale takes here
- •Listed to under contract: a median of 16 days, across 130 Edgewater closings Resideline tracked in the last 12 months
- •Contract to closing: a median of 24 days, across 101 Edgewater closings Resideline tracked in the last 12 months
The Edgewater angle
Edgewater turned in 211 tracked closings over the last 12 months, a median closed sale price of $490,000, and a middle half of $425,000 to $599,900. Prices cluster more tightly here than in most markets we track, and a tight middle changes what the work is: the argument is rarely about the level of the market and almost always about whether the subject is an ordinary local sale. Slightly more of the band sits above the median than below it, so the premium end has a little more distance in it than the discount end.

The closings we track across the Edgewater Census-designated area are not limited to listing-service sales: they also include foreclosure deeds, estate and family transfers, and other off-market sales that portal medians exclude, which is why 18% of the 211 closings in this window never appeared on a listing service, and the median of MLS-listed sales alone was $498,000.

Does a tight price range in Edgewater mean the median is a valuation?
No. A tight middle half means the median is a better starting estimate than it would be in a scattered market, not that properties stop differing. Your task shifts from establishing the general price level to testing whether the subject is typical and quantifying the ways it is not. In a tightly clustered market an unusual property looks out of place quickly, so a defensible number needs matched closings behind it rather than a percentage adjustment off the middle.
